Brady Sullivan is seeking an experienced and dedicated Project Manager. This position requires the individual to oversee the daily coordination of internal and external agencies as it relates to the management of an assigned project. Ensures high levels of customer satisfaction through professional project management and the use of highly developed interpersonal skills. Uses best practices and company procedures to ensure timely completion of project(s) in order to maximize profitability. Must be able to work in a fast-paced environment with demonstrated ability to juggle multiple competing tasks and demands.

  • Working knowledge of the various trades associated with construction project management: plumbing, electrical, painting, carpentry and HVAC.
  • Develops, monitors and tracks timelines for all phases of a project in order to meet company established completion date.
  • Develops, monitors and tracks budgets and contracts for all phases of a project in order to meet company established completion date.
  • Ensures material availability for each job by using a three-bid acquisition system to achieve timely and cost effective purchases of job materials.
  • Coordinates with customers and other Brady Sullivan employees to ensure change orders and/or issues are addressed and handled.
  • Supervises the Maintenance Technicians assigned to the project.
  • Establishes respectful working relationships with subordinates, outside vendors and sub-contractors.
  • Provides weekly feedback to the Director of Operations using electronic mail to remit “15-Minute Report.
  • Conducts daily walk-through of project(s) site to ensure sub-contractor standards of work are met.
  • Comprehends blueprints, job specifications, proposals, architectural drawings.
  • Maintains job files in order to track project(s) and retrieve historical data when necessary.
  • Makes most decisions with minimal or no supervision. Able to effectively prioritize tasks with limited input from management.

Skills:

  • Must have high level of interpersonal skills.
  • Position continually requires demonstrated poise, tact and diplomacy.
  • Work requires continual education and training in all construction trades as it applies to project management.
  • Ability to resolve conflict in professional, timely manner
  • Must be able to work with multiple priorities. 

Education/ Training:

  • High School Education
  • Industry standard licenses and/or certifications a plus.
